description Product Description

This compound is primarily utilized in research and development within the field of neuroscience and pharmacology. It serves as a selective antagonist for certain dopamine receptor subtypes, making it valuable for studying the role of dopamine in the brain. Its application extends to investigating neurological disorders such as Parkinson's disease, schizophrenia, and other dopamine-related conditions. Additionally, it is used in the synthesis of radiolabeled compounds for imaging studies, aiding in the visualization and understanding of receptor distribution and function in the brain. Its unique structure allows it to interact specifically with targeted receptors, providing insights into therapeutic drug design and the development of treatments for psychiatric and neurological diseases.
